摘要
混料模块是砂型3D打印机的重要组成部分,混料模块中下料称重系统的下料准确性对3D打印砂型的质量有着直接的影响。分析了下料准确性的影响因素,并对减少飞料量、改进控制方式两种提高下料准确性的方法进行了研究;实验证明通过减小飞料量并结合改进控制方式可以有效地提高混料模块下料准确性。
The mixing module is an important part of sand 3D printer,and the accuracy of the feeding weighing system in the mixing module has a direct impact on the quality of 3D printed sand.This paper analyzes the factors affecting the accuracy of blanking,and studies two methods to improve the accuracy of blanking by reducing the amount of flying material and improving the control mode.The experimental results show that the accuracy of mixing module can be effectively improved by reducing the amount of fly material and improving the control mode.
